    This study investigated coronary heart disease risk factors and Type A-B Behavior in twins. Certain psychological tests correlated with Type A-B Behavior and risk factors, suggesting potential screening tools.

    Area of Science:

    • Behavioral genetics
    • Cardiovascular disease research
    • Psychological assessment

    Background:

    • Coronary heart disease (CHD) risk factors are multifactorial.
    • Behavior Pattern Type A-B is a known correlate of CHD.
    • Twin studies are valuable for disentangling genetic and environmental influences on complex traits.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To examine heritability of CHD risk factors and Behavior Pattern Type A-B in middle-aged twins.
    • To identify psychological correlates of Behavior Pattern Type A-B and CHD risk factors.
    • To explore the potential of psychological assessments for screening Type A-B Behavior.

    Main Methods:

    • Studied 190 twin pairs (93 MZ, 97 DZ) aged 44-55 years.
    • Assessed CHD risk factors and Behavior Pattern Type A-B.

  • Administered psychological tests including MMPI, CPI, Cattell PF, Gough Adjective Check List (ACL), and Thurstone Temperament Schedule (TTS).
  • Main Results:

    • Heritability was significant only for Thurstone Temperament Schedule (TTS) scales.
    • Twelve ACL scales and five TTS scales correlated significantly with Behavior Pattern Type A-B.
    • These scales also showed correlations with CHD risk factors like blood pressure and serum lipids.

    Conclusions:

    • Psychological scales, specifically certain ACL and TTS scales, show promise for assessing Behavior Pattern Type A-B.
    • These findings suggest potential for developing new screening questionnaires for Type A-B Behavior.
    • This research contributes to understanding the interplay of genetics, behavior, and cardiovascular health.
